Cash refers to the most liquid asset of ICON PLC, which is listed under current asset account on ICON PLC balance sheet and usually includes currency, coins, checking accounts, and not deposited checks received from ICON PLC customers. The amounts must be unrestricted with restricted cash listed in a different ICON PLC account. It is the total amount of money in the form of currency that a company has in its possession. This includes all bills, coins, and funds in bank accounts. Pair Trading with ICON PLC

One of the main advantages of trading using pair correlations is that every trade hedges away some risk. Because there are two separate transactions required, even if ICON PLC position performs unexpectedly, the other equity can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in ICON PLC will appreciate offsetting losses from the drop in the long position's value.

The correlation of ICON PLC is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as ICON PLC mo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if ICON PLC mo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.
